Neighborhood Overview – Trembling Earth Sports Complex

Trembling Earth Sports Complex is situated on the southern edge of Waycross, Georgia, a city steeped in railroad history and surrounded by natural beauty. The complex is conveniently located off Highway 84 (Victory Drive), a major artery that provides easy access to and from the city center and surrounding areas. Getting to Waycross typically involves driving, as it is not a major hub for public transportation or extensive ride-sharing networks. The nearest significant airport is Jacksonville International Airport (JAX), located approximately 80 miles south, which can be a 1.5 to 2-hour drive depending on traffic. For those driving from within Georgia or Florida, Highway 84 serves as the primary route, connecting to larger interstates like I-95 to the east. Approach the complex from Victory Drive; while there are multiple entrances, the main access points are well-signed and can experience congestion during major tournaments or events. Arriving at least 45 minutes to an hour before scheduled games is advisable to allow ample time for parking, team check-in, and finding your designated field or facility within the expansive grounds.

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Waycross typically brings mild temperatures, with daytime highs often in the 50s and 60s Fahrenheit. While generally pleasant for outdoor activities, cold fronts can bring lower temperatures, requiring layers and jackets. Rain is common, and cloudy days can make the air feel cooler. Visitors should pack comfortable, adaptable clothing and check forecasts for any significant drops in temperature.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ring and early summer are characterized by warming temperatures, with highs climbing into the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it. Humidity begins to increase, and afternoon thunderstorms are frequent. Light, breathable clothing is recommended. Sunscreen and hats are advisable for prolonged outdoor time, and having a light rain jacket or umbrella can be useful for unexpected showers.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er in Waycross is hot and humid, with daytime temperatures consistently in the high 80s and 90s Fahrenheit, often feeling hotter with humidity. Long periods outdoors require diligent hydration, sun protection, and quick-drying athletic wear. Be prepared for intense heat that can affect game endurance and spectator comfort. Early morning or late afternoon game times are often preferred.

🍂

Fall season

Fall brings a welcome reprieve from the summer heat, with temperatures gradually cooling into the 60s and 70s Fahrenheit. Humidity decreases, making for very comfortable conditions for sports. Early fall can still have warm days, while late fall brings cooler air. Layering clothing is a good strategy, as mornings can be cool and afternoons warm.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is a frequent occurrence throughout the year in Waycross, particularly during spring and summer thunderstorms. Snow is rare and typically does not accumulate. Wet conditions can lead to field delays or cancellations, so checking event status is crucial during periods of heavy rain. Umbrellas and waterproof outerwear are practical for navigating wet conditions between games.
